Eigenvalue collision and exotic preservers on semisimple operators
Continuous commutativity and spectrum preservers on normal matrices are conjugations or transpose conjugations, while on semisimple and general matrices they admit more exotic forms determined by the local regularity of complex conjugation near coincident eigenvalues.

The combinatorics of permuting and preserving curve-bound spectra
Continuous spectrum- and commutativity-preserving maps on normal matrices with spectra in a given interval image are conjugations, transpose conjugations, or spectrum orderings with fixed eigenspaces.
